Updating

Tell us your dates, and we will find the most accurate rates and availability for you

Updating

Holiday Rentals in Pennington - Holiday Lettings - Villas

All filters (3)

Filters (4)

Clear filters

1 Holiday homes

Great rentals within 20 miles that match your search

Holiday home in Bela Bela

Bela Bela house

  • 3 bedrooms
  • 4 bathrooms
  • sleeps 8

from £307 / night

£1,823 / week

1 / 70

Great rentals within 20 miles that match your search

These homes match some but not all of your filters.

Clear all filters

Holiday home in Addo Elephant National Park

Addo Elephant National Park house

  • 3 bedrooms
  • 1 bathroom
  • sleeps 7

1 filter does not match: Private outdoor pool (heated)

from £71 / night

£497 / week

1 / 10

Great rentals within 20 miles that match your search

Addo holiday home rental

Addo house

  • 2 bedrooms
  • 1 bathroom
  • sleeps 6

2 filters do not match: Cooker, Private outdoor pool (heated)

from £71 / night

£497 / week

1 / 9

Great rentals within 20 miles that match your search

Home rental in Germiston

Germiston house

  • 4 bedrooms
  • 3 bathrooms
  • sleeps 10

2 filters do not match: Cooker, Cot available

from £183 / night

£1,280 / week

1 / 69

Great rentals within 20 miles that match your search

Home accommodation in Vilanculos Islands

Vilanculos Islands house

  • 3 bedrooms
  • 4 bathrooms
  • sleeps 10

2 filters do not match: Cooker, Cot available

from £3,200 / night

£24,318 / week

1 / 33

Great rentals within 20 miles that match your search

Home rental in Hogsback

Hogsback house

  • 3 bedrooms
  • 2 bathrooms
  • sleeps 6

2 filters do not match: Cooker, Private outdoor pool (heated)

from £165 / night

£1,152 / week

1 / 7

Great rentals within 20 miles that match your search

Home rental in Salt Rock

Salt Rock house

  • 3 bedrooms
  • 3 bathrooms
  • sleeps 6

2 filters do not match: Cooker, Private outdoor pool (heated)

from £160 / night

£992 / week

1 / 25

Great rentals within 20 miles that match your search

Holiday home in Bela Bela

Bela Bela house

  • 5 bedrooms
  • 5 bathrooms
  • sleeps 12

1 filter does not match: Cot available

from £339 / night

£2,013 / week

1 / 74

Great rentals within 20 miles that match your search

Holiday home with shared pool in Hluhluwe

Hluhluwe house

  • 3 bedrooms
  • 2 bathrooms
  • sleeps 10

1 filter does not match: Private outdoor pool (heated)

from £126 / night

£494 / week

1 / 9

Great rentals within 20 miles that match your search

Holiday home rental

Hoedspruit house

  • 4 bedrooms
  • 4 bathrooms
  • sleeps 8

1 filter does not match: Private outdoor pool (heated)

from £235 / night

£1,374 / week

1 / 26

Great rentals within 20 miles that match your search

Holiday home in Krugersdorp

Krugersdorp house

  • 2 bedrooms
  • 1 bathroom
  • sleeps 6

1 filter does not match: Private outdoor pool (heated)

from £33 / night

£231 / week

1 / 20

Great rentals within 20 miles that match your search

Holiday home in Johannesburg

Johannesburg house

  • 3 bedrooms
  • 2 bathrooms
  • sleeps 6

2 filters do not match: Cooker, Private outdoor pool (heated)

from £183 / night

£915 / week

1 / 11

Great rentals within 20 miles that match your search

Home rental in Randburg

Randburg house

  • 2 bedrooms
  • 1 bathroom
  • sleeps 4

1 filter does not match: Private outdoor pool (heated)

from £63 / night

£436 / week

1 / 25

Great rentals within 20 miles that match your search

Holiday home with swimming pool in Marloth Park

Marloth Park house

  • 6 bedrooms
  • 6 bathrooms
  • sleeps 12

1 filter does not match: Private outdoor pool (heated)

from £110 / night

£768 / week

1 / 26

Great rentals within 20 miles that match your search

Holiday home with swimming pool in Marloth Park

Marloth Park house

  • 4 bedrooms
  • 3 bathrooms
  • sleeps 8

1 filter does not match: Private outdoor pool (heated)

from £184 / night

£1,260 / week

1 / 19

Great rentals within 20 miles that match your search

Holiday home with swimming pool in Marloth Park

Marloth Park house

  • 1 bedroom
  • 1 bathroom
  • sleeps 2

2 filters do not match: Cooker, Cot available

from £68 / night

£476 / week

1 / 21

Great rentals within 20 miles that match your search

Holiday home with swimming pool, golf nearby in Mtunzini

Mtunzini house

  • 4 bedrooms
  • 2 bathrooms
  • sleeps 10

1 filter does not match: Cot available

from £247 / night

£2,265 / week

1 / 49

Great rentals within 20 miles that match your search

Holiday home in Johannesburg

Johannesburg house

  • 3 bedrooms
  • 5 bathrooms
  • sleeps 6

1 filter does not match: Cot available

from £179 / night

£1,125 - £1,765 / week

1 / 31

Great rentals within 20 miles that match your search

Holiday home in Sheffield Beach

Sheffield Beach house

  • 7 bedrooms
  • 7 bathrooms
  • sleeps 15

1 filter does not match: Cot available

from £592 / night

£4,144 / week

1 / 20

Great rentals within 20 miles that match your search

Holiday guest house in Vryheid

Vryheid guest house

  • 13 bedrooms
  • 17 bathrooms
  • sleeps 35

2 filters do not match: Property type, Private outdoor pool (heated)

from £30 / night

£207 / week

1 / 12

Great rentals within 20 miles that match your search

Grahamstown holiday cottage rental

Grahamstown cottage

  • 6 bedrooms
  • 6 bathrooms
  • sleeps 30

2 filters do not match: Property type, Private outdoor pool (heated)

from £15 / night

£105 / week

1 / 5

Great rentals within 20 miles that match your search

Holiday guest house with shared pool in Praia da Barra

Praia da Barra guest house

  • 5 bedrooms
  • 1 bathroom
  • sleeps 6

2 filters do not match: Property type, Private outdoor pool (heated)

from £56 / night

£391 / week

1 / 12

Great rentals within 20 miles that match your search

Guest house rental in Praia da Barra with shared pool

Praia da Barra guest house

  • 1 bedroom
  • 1 bathroom
  • sleeps 2

2 filters do not match: Property type, Private outdoor pool (heated)

from £29 / night

£199 / week

1 / 13

Great rentals within 20 miles that match your search

Praia da Barra holiday guest house rental

Praia da Barra guest house

  • 1 bedroom
  • 1 bathroom
  • sleeps 3

2 filters do not match: Property type, Private outdoor pool (heated)

from £39 / night

£269 / week

1 / 14

Great rentals within 20 miles that match your search

Holiday guest house in Praia da Barra

Praia da Barra guest house

  • 2 bedrooms
  • 1 bathroom
  • sleeps 6

2 filters do not match: Property type, Private outdoor pool (heated)

from £56 / night

£391 / week

1 / 15

Great rentals within 20 miles that match your search

Holiday apartment accommodation

Ballito apartment

  • 2 bedrooms
  • 2 bathrooms
  • sleeps 4

2 filters do not match: Property type, Private outdoor pool (heated)

from £63 / night

£441 / week

1 / 14

Great rentals within 20 miles that match your search

Holiday home with swimming pool, golf nearby in Chintsa

Chintsa house

  • 5 bedrooms
  • 4 bathrooms
  • sleeps 10

1 filter does not match: Private outdoor pool (heated)

from £172 / night

£1,203 / week

1 / 24

Great rentals within 20 miles that match your search

Holiday home in St Lucia

St Lucia house

  • 3 bedrooms
  • 2 bathrooms
  • sleeps 8

1 filter does not match: Private outdoor pool (heated)

from £96 / night

£672 / week

1 / 32

Great rentals within 20 miles that match your search

Holiday home with golf nearby in Ballito

Ballito house

  • 3 bedrooms
  • 3 bathrooms
  • sleeps 6

1 filter does not match: Private outdoor pool (heated)

from £247 / night

£1,718 / week

1 / 10

Great rentals within 20 miles that match your search

Holiday home in Underberg

Underberg house

  • 5 bedrooms
  • 4 bathrooms
  • sleeps 11

1 filter does not match: Private outdoor pool (heated)

from £166 / night

£190 / week

1 / 43

Great rentals within 20 miles that match your search

Holiday home with swimming pool in Hazyview

Hazyview house

  • 3 bedrooms
  • 3 bathrooms
  • sleeps 6

1 filter does not match: Private outdoor pool (heated)

from £220 / night

£1,536 / week

1 / 8

Great rentals within 20 miles that match your search

Holiday home with swimming pool in Durban

Durban house

  • 3 bedrooms
  • 3 bathrooms
  • sleeps 8

2 filters do not match: Cooker, Private outdoor pool (heated)

from £172 / night

£1,031 - £1,352 / week

1 / 12

Great rentals within 20 miles that match your search

Holiday home in Fouriesburg

Fouriesburg house

  • 3 bedrooms
  • 3 bathrooms
  • sleeps 7

2 filters do not match: Cooker, Private outdoor pool (heated)

from £144 / night

£1,002 / week

1 / 12

Great rentals within 20 miles that match your search

Holiday tented camp letting

Hilton tented camp

  • 3 bedrooms
  • 1 bathroom
  • sleeps 6

3 filters do not match: Property type, Cooker, Private outdoor pool (heated)

from £92 / night

£458 - £3,625 / week

1 / 13

Great rentals within 20 miles that match your search

Holiday villa in Hoedspruit

Hoedspruit villa

  • 3 bedrooms
  • 2 bathrooms
  • sleeps 6

2 filters do not match: Property type, Cot available

from £211 / night

£1,476 / week

1 / 19

Great rentals within 20 miles that match your search

Holiday guest house in Hoedspruit

Hoedspruit guest house

  • 2 bedrooms
  • 2 bathrooms
  • sleeps 4

2 filters do not match: Property type, Cot available

from £202 / night

£1,280 / week

1 / 9

Great rentals within 20 miles that match your search

Holiday apartment rental

Sandton apartment

  • 2 bedrooms
  • 1 bathroom
  • sleeps 5

2 filters do not match: Property type, Private outdoor pool (heated)

from £87 / night

£561 / week

1 / 13

Great rentals within 20 miles that match your search

Holiday cottage accommodation

Marloth Park cottage

  • 2 bedrooms
  • 2 bathrooms
  • sleeps 6

2 filters do not match: Property type, Private outdoor pool (heated)

from £74 / night

£517 / week

1 / 21

Great rentals within 20 miles that match your search

Cottage rental in Fourways

Fourways cottage

  • 1 bedroom
  • 1 bathroom
  • sleeps 3

2 filters do not match: Property type, Private outdoor pool (heated)

from £62 / night

£429 / week

1 / 13

Great rentals within 20 miles that match your search

Fourways holiday apartment accommodation

Fourways apartment

  • 1 bedroom
  • 1 bathroom
  • sleeps 3

2 filters do not match: Property type, Private outdoor pool (heated)

from £76 / night

£532 / week

1 / 10

×

Also consider